Jagermeister launches global campaign “NIGHT LIGHTS” with post malone

Whether it’s bartenders, artists or creatives: Restrictions weigh heavily on those who make nightlife possible. International superstar Post Malone and Jägermeister continue to support nightlife communities worldwide by raising awareness for the #SAVETHENIGHT initiative and continuing financial support for artists worldwide via “Meister Fund”. Both Post Malone and the brand are united by their passion for music and together they amplify the cause of the initiative introduced by Jägermeister.

With Post Malone as an ambassador of #SAVETHENIGHT Jägermeister launches the 60 second video “Night Lights” shot by Academy Award-nominated director Zachary Heinzerling – a tribute to nightlife. The short film celebrates the high energy moments of the night and celebrates the excitement for the return to the clubs and stages, honoring artists, local communities, and venues around the world.

“We wanted to help raise awareness and send support to the whole nightlife community & anyone who’s been affected during these tough times. All the artists, the creatives, the staff - this is for you”, says Post Malone.

“With the long-term commitment of #SAVETHENIGHT we want to continue to provide sustainable support for the global nightlife scene. My special thanks to everyone involved in this incredible project,” says Wolfgang Moeller, Global CMO at Mast-Jägermeister SE. “To share this commitment with a partner like Post Malone is a great honor for us.”

Limited Edition Bottle to #SAVETHENIGHT

In mid-September 2021 Jägermeister will launch an exclusive Limited Edition Bottle in selected markets as an additional way for brand enthusiasts and supporters to actively invest in the future of nightlife: Part of the proceeds go directly to the Meister Fund – a financial support system that benefits projects and innovative ideas of artists and creatives from the Meister network of #SAVETHENIGHT. ­

 A design inspired by the comeback of nightlife

The unique design of the bottle tells the story of #SAVETHENIGHT. The Limited Edition – which appears completely dark – visualizes the shutdown of nightlife worldwide. Since Jägermeister is best served ice cold, the magic happens as soon as the liquid has reached its perfect drinking temperature of -18 degrees inside the freezer: The design on the front – with the #SAVETHENIGHT logo printed in gold – starts changing and color appears. The Jägermeister core elements printed directly on the bottle show up and it literally brings life back to nightlife.

“The thermochromic effect symbolizes the support that brings us closer to switching the lights of nightlife back on and helps it to return in all the colors it has to offer,” says Wolfgang Moeller, Global CMO at Mast-Jägermeister SE. “We want to raise awareness for the social meaning of the night and we are hopeful to celebrate the best nights of our lives again soon.”

An emotional manifesto printed on the bottle emphasizes the cultural significance of nightlife: “The Night is ours to save. It’s where we find our freedom, our flow, ourselves. Together, with the Meisters, we will keep the beat alive.” 

About #SAVETHENIGHT

With the global initiative #SAVETHENIGHT Jägermeister has been able to support more than 1,500 artists, creatives, and bartenders from more than 60 countries. It raises awareness for the situation of thousands of creatives as well as the people that deeply miss going out and celebrating the night. It inspires people all around the world to team up with Jägermeister.

Through the Meister Fund as part of #SAVETHENIGHT Jägermeister helps artists and creators financially so they can craft various forms of art for audiences to book and enjoy on the platform www.save-the-night.com – from Meister Drop-In’s to other entertaining content.
